Risk Management Innovations in Corporate Banking

Risk management innovations in corporate banking involve adopting advanced tools and strategies to mitigate financial and operational risks. Innovative approaches enhance the ability of banks to identify, assess, and control potential threats more effectively.

Key developments include the use of artificial intelligence (AI) for predictive analytics, real-time monitoring, and fraud detection. These technologies enable banks to respond swiftly to emerging risks and improve decision-making.

Banks are also leveraging big data analytics and machine learning to recognize patterns and anomalies, enhancing credit risk assessments and reducing default probabilities. Additionally, automation streamlines compliance with regulations, minimizing operational risk.

Incorporating blockchain technology is another innovation, providing secure and transparent transaction records. This reduces fraud risk and enhances trust in corporate banking operations. Overall, these risk management innovations support resilient banking services and foster confidence among corporate clients.

Regulatory Considerations and Challenges in Product Innovation

Regulatory considerations and challenges significantly influence the development of innovative corporate banking products. Financial institutions must ensure their solutions comply with evolving laws and regulations to avoid penalties and reputational risks.

Key challenges include navigating multiple jurisdictions’ regulatory frameworks, which often differ significantly. Compliance requires ongoing monitoring and adaptation to policy changes, especially in areas like anti-money laundering (AML), data privacy, and cybersecurity.

Institutions also face the complexity of balancing innovation with risk management. Innovative products must meet strict regulatory standards while maintaining operational efficiency and customer satisfaction. Failure to do so can hinder product deployment and limit competitive advantage.

To address these challenges, financial institutions often adopt a proactive approach by collaborating with regulators during product development. Some may also invest in compliance technology, including the following:

  1. Robust data protection measures and encryption processes
  2. Regular compliance audits and staff training programs
  3. Clear documentation of product features and risk assessments
  4. Close engagement with legal advisors and regulatory bodies
